Fig. 5: Example results for the retrieval task.

From: CLOOME: contrastive learning unlocks bioimaging databases for queries with chemical structures

Fig. 5

On a hold-out test set, the five molecules for which representations are the most similar to the query image are shown along with their corresponding images. Blue boxes mark the query image and its matched molecular structure, i.e., the matched pair. CLOOME can be used to retrieve molecules that could produce similar biological effects on treated cells, i.e., bioisosteres.
